Transaction 953757a46886cb58d68c1e3e441f02ee61b2c8fbeb47f7569936bb7ff2e49c60
1 Input
2 Outputs
- 953757a46886cb58d68c1e3e441f02ee61b2c8fbeb47f7569936bb7ff2e49c60:0
- 953757a46886cb58d68c1e3e441f02ee61b2c8fbeb47f7569936bb7ff2e49c60:1
value 440851611
address 11FsMeZhgSbfNydLL8BoYQcaihdMAvDYh
value 42700000
address 1AR1QzYHTJheea97WakaAfqttPe1X9ULT3